    <description>For years I have been using the function `AirTemperatureData` to get daily average temperatures for 11 German cities.  &#xD;
Now, I do not get any data after August 24, 2025. All time series are obviously not continued.&#xD;
Is this my fault?  &#xD;
Does anybody know how to access data for Germany after August 24, 2025?  &#xD;
Here is the command I used:&#xD;
&#xD;
    airtemp = &#xD;
     AirTemperatureData[&#xD;
      stationen, {DateObject[{2007, 10, 1}], DateObject[{2026, 5, 20}], &#xD;
       &amp;#034;Day&amp;#034;}]&#xD;
&#xD;
where &amp;#034;stationen&amp;#034; is the list of 11 cities defined as Entities (note, this code worked for the last 5 years)&#xD;
&#xD;
any help is highly appreciated.</description>
